On Tue May 07, 2013 at 17:51:42 +0800, Chao-Jui Chang wrote:
Is trustzone working on exynos 4412 platform?
It is generally supposed to work but this also depends on the particular board/system due to board configs etc.
I have selected the follow item in Fiasco config menu:
- Platform Timer (Multi-core timer)
- Use ExtGic
- Execution Model (TrustZone normal side)
But it stop at early stage. Same result for Execution Model (Standard mode). but no message for Execution Model (TrustZone secure side).
One reason could be the configured amount of memory, is it 1023 or 1024MB?
If the trustzone is disabled in u-boot, the 'Standard mode' works fine.
That could also indicate that.
